Most of the Irish immigrants who came to the US following the potato famine of the 1840s settled in?

Most of the Irish immigrants who came to the United States to escape the Potato Famine settled in and around Boston and New York. The main reason was they didn't come to the country with very much money, and lacked the resources to move further inland.
